civireport and how it treats money fields
December 09, 2009, 09:07:26 pm
a csv from civireport is giving us this as a column
£ 30.00
£ 30.00
£ 40.00

while from Find Contributions = export I get

30
30
40

with no currency.

The ones from CiviReport are not being recognised by NeoOffice as numbers/currency (and find/replace doesn't seem to even be able to strip out the currency symbol - is this a problem with how neooffice deals with such data? or how it comes out of civireport?
